Diversification
An investment strategy that reduces risk by allocating investments among various financial instruments, industries, or other categories.
Negatively Correlated
A relationship between two variables in which one variable increases as the other decreases.
Expected Value
A calculation in statistics that quantifies the average outcome of a random event over a large number of occurrences.
Mean
The average value of a set of numbers, calculated by dividing the sum of all values by the number of values.
